Spanish language resources – Language Links Database

Spanish – also called Castilian is a Romance language that originated in Castile, a region of Spain. Approximately 414 million people speak Spanish as a native language, making it second only to Mandarin in terms of its number of native speakers worldwide. There are more than 500 million Spanish speakers as a first or second language, and 20 million students of Spanish as a foreign language. Spanish is one of the six official languages of the United Nations, and it is used as an official language by the European Union, Mercosur, and the Pacific Alliance.

More informationWikipedia

Native speakers: 470 million (2010)

Official language in20 countries

Spanish Grammar and Pronunciation

  • Wikiversity - Elementary course
  • Wikiversity - Intermediate Spanish course
  • WikiBooks - Course for beginners
  • MiT - OpenCourseWare for Spanish I
  • MiT - OpenCourseWare for Spanish II
  • MiT - OpenCourseWare for Spanish III
  • MiT - OpenCourseWare for Spanish IV
  • FSI Language Courses - The website contains following courses (each with separate textbook (pdf) and audio (mp3)): Spanish ProgrammaticSpanish BasicSpanish FASTSuplemento para SecretariasTesting Kit – French and SpanishHeadstart for Latin AmericaHeadstart for Puerto RicoHeadstart for Spain
  • - All the lessons contain audio and are all offered for free. We will learn the alphabet together. We will also review some simple grammar rules, practice common phrases, and we will have fun memorizing many important vocabulary lists.
  • MyLanguages - Courses about adjectives, adverbs, articles, gender (feminine, masculine…), negation, nouns, numbers, phrases, plural, prepositions, pronouns, questions, verbs, vocabulary, exercises
  • ILanguages - This site is designed to teach you and help you learn Spanish for free through vocabulary, phrases, grammar and flashcards (vocabulary trainer)
  • Hello-World - Lessons for children. More than 700 FREE Spanish games and activities.
  • - Over 370 lessons
  • University of Texas - The University of Texas at Austin offers a vast index of free Spanish resources for beginner, intermediate, advanced, and superior levels. Every lesson has videos, grammar, vocabulary, phrases, and podcasts. The beginner material contains 15 tasks. Each includes an interview so that you can listen to native speakers of Spanish. For more advanced students, the material focuses on role plays. This course includes a comprehensive grammar index with an emphasis on expression, grammar tips, and pronouns. All the resources are completely free. 
  • BBC - BBC lessons and courses, grammar, vocabulary and games
  • - Medical Spanish for Healthcare Providers
  • Destinos: An Introduction to Spanish. A video instructional series in Spanish for college and high school classrooms and adult learners; 52 half-hour video programs divided into two parts (Part I programs 1-26, Part II programs 27-52), audiocassettes, music CD, video and audio scripts, and coordinated books.
  • Poliglo‘s courses to learn languages are structured using 1000 words to learn. Each course has four levels, and each level has 250 words, the first section is “250 words” the second section is “500 words”, the third section is “750 words” and the fourth and last section is “1000 words”.
  • - Vocabulary lists and grammar
  • - Think of Conjuguemos as an online workbook for your Spanish language students. The site stores a large amount of practice activities, with more exercises added during the year by our users. Teachers can also create their own activities.
  • - 20 hours of introductory Spanish course material
  • - Free tutorials – Spanish Pronunciation, Grammar, Vocabulary, Verbs, Travel Helper, Daily Word, Cultural Notes, Idioms
  • - A lot of language courses. You must pay after completing the course in order to receive a certificate, however completing a course is free.
  • - Grammar reference in Spanish
  • - Over 200 (mostly short) study guides and learning tips compiled here by teachers, professors and native speakers of the Spanish language
  • - Podcast and lessons for learners of all levels
  • - Free courses, games, verb conjugation and lessons for kids, videos and tons of other resources for learners of all levels
  • - Here you can find a 100% free guide to quickly learn Spanish. We only included what could be very useful to the learner who wants to speak in a short time, while still touching many areas as possible.
  • - Tons of free interactive lessons and games
  • - Spanish Phonetics Guide (and dialects guide)
  • - Grammar and different study modules
  • - Resources for teaching and learning Spanish
  • - Spanish Tutorials Index: Basic Phrases, Vocabulary and Grammar
  • - Grammar reference, dictionary, verb conjugator, community and more
  • - Study guides and articles
  • - “We present a facility for the interactive drilling in Spanish Grammar.”
  • - A concise outline of essential grammar structures based on John Turner’s All the Spanish Grammar You Really Need to Know
  • - A collection of free online lessons with sections for Beginner, Intermediate, and Advanced learners
  • - This website includes free resources for students, teachers, and lovers of the Spanish language
  • - Interactive grammar exercises
  • - This site includes all kinds of free content, with free grammar tutorials, worksheets, phrases, games and a dictionary
  • - We have online lessons, vocabulary lists, useful phrases, a glossary, as well as free printable worksheets, all listed below. Our materials are perfect for those learning basic or intermediate Spanish.
  • - We have online lessons, vocabulary lists, useful phrases, a glossary, as well as free printable worksheets, all listed below. Our materials are perfect for those learning basic or intermediate Spanish.
  • - The Classroom contains dozens of grammar lessons. Each lesson includes explanations in English, voice files and links to Gym, where you can practice the topics studied in the lesson.
  • - Free Business Lessons
  • Linguanaut - Free Spanish lessons online, from Phrases, Alphabet, Numbers, Adjectives, Prepositions, Verbs, Vocabulary used in Spain. Most of the lessons contain expressions used for the everyday life conversations, through them you can learn how to say specific sentences, so they might come handy if you memorize them.
  • - Grammar and vocabulary
  • - This site presents a series of language exercises for the purpose of facilitating the learning and teaching of Spanish in the Internet environment (this site does not exist anymore).
  • - Train your Spanish with our interactive online exercises (also in German)
  • - Vocabulary and grammar lessons with audio
  • - Grammar and thematic vocabulary
  • - 200 language tests
  • - Resource Guide for Students
  • - Our free worksheets are designed to help you improve you Spanish skills through various learning techniques, applying what you have learned in class and guiding you in your future studies.
  • - The website offers you the free lessons online, with video lessons and interesting information that will help you to improve your Spanish
  • - This site was created to offer free lessons for both children and parents, whether for educational purposes, or just for fun. We have different lessons for each age, and everything is designed to make learning fun.
    There are plenty of interactive activities for you to engage in, and offer basic introductory Spanish skills. With all of the games, lessons, tips, and resources, you’ll be speaking Spanish in no time!  
  • Verbix - Online verb conjugator
  • - The website is full of free Spanish language learning materials for all levels and all ages
  • - Fully integrated course has a practical focus and includes a wide range of interactive exercises for you to do online. Grammar is introduced gradually and in context, and explanations, examples and exercises are provided as needed.
  • - 150+ beginner expressions, questions and sentences to master Spanish conversation.
  • SQA Easy/Middle/Hard - Find past papers and marking instructions for your revision. You can search by topic and or refine by subject and level. To add the matching marking instructions simply tick the box.

Spanish Vocabulary

  • - Vocabulary quiz. For each answer you get right, the website donates 10 grains of rice to the United Nations World Food Program. PLEASE support this noble cause!
  • Wikivoyage - Extensive Phrasebook
  • TravLang - Vocabulary for travelers
  • - Thousands of vocabulary and language learning games and quizzes
  • Pinterest - Hundreds of beautiful posters and pictures with thematic vocabulary
  • - Fun games that are sure to improve your knowledge of the most useful Spanish verbs, both regular and irregular
  • Digital Dialects - Vocabulary learning games
  • Field Support - Language survival kits for Colombia, Mexico and Venezuela
  • Loecsen - Basic words and useful phrases you will need for your trip (with pdf and audio)
  • SurfaceLanguages - Learn phrases – these cover a wide variety of  topics, including the numbers, days, greetings and the months. Listen to and copy the native speech, and learn with flashcards.
  • - Over 160 tongue twisters
  • MasterAnyLanguage - Flashcards for learners of all levels
  • - Lessons and tens of thousands of flashcards
  • - Lessons and tens of thousands of flashcards
  • InternetPolyglot - Vocabulary learning games
  • - Thematic vocabulary (on the left)
  • Wiktionary - A 207-word frequency list
  • - picture dictionary – picture dictionary with more than 2000 illustrations organized into topics
    vocabulary – database containing about 2000 most important meanings organized into topics
    flashcards – a simple game allowing you to learn vocabulary
    vocabulary trainer – a simple game allowing you to train your knowledge of vocabulary
    learn vocabulary – an application which allows you to learn Spanish vocabulary
    phrases – phrasebook of about 200 most frequently used phrases organized into topics
    grammar – an overview of the grammar basics
    examples – database of example sentences in Spanish


Spanish Reading Materials

Spanish Dictionaries


Spanish Listening and Video Resources


  • - Audiria is an online tool which freely supports your learning of Spanish, offering podcasts to increase your knowledge of the language
  • LibriVox - Over 150 free public domain audiobooks read by volunteers from around the world
  • One Minute Spanish – In this podcast you’ll be learning just enough Spanish to get by on a holiday or business trip to Spain. Each lesson includes just over a minute of language-learning content, so there’s no excuse not to learn! Remember, even a few phrases of a language can help you make friends and enjoy travel more, 16 lessons.
  • Coffee Break Spanish– aimed at total beginners, 158 lessons
  • Show Time Spanish – podcast is for intermediate and advanced learners, 53 lessons
  • Insta Spanish Lessons – interactive podcast contains listening comprehension exercises and grammar lessons for students of all levels, 11 lessons
  • Spanish A+ – Our great dialogs teach you new vocabulary in context, and our excellent learning tips guarantee that you’ll make progress in your Spanish studies., 38 lessons
  • ITunes Learn to Speak Spanish, 44 lessons
  • Notes in Spanish Intermediate - This is the genuine Spanish you will never find in a text book or classroom, 46 lessons
  • - Each “episodes” tells a story, with most later episodes building upon the plot from earlier episodes. Free transcript included
  • Learn Spanish the Rojas Way - These podcasts are for the Intermediate and Advanced Spanish Speaker who would like to sharpen their Spanish skills. The fine points of the language will be presented and explored through a variety of topics to include; music, history, culture, literature and food, 78 lessons
  • - In our course we emphasize all aspects of language learning from listening comprehension, rapid vocabulary expansion, exposure to Spanish grammar and common idiomatic expressions, to pronunciation practice and interactive grammar exercises.
    In our program we discuss the Weekly News, Spanish grammar, and Spanish expressions, and much more at a slow pace so that you can understand almost every word and sentence.
  • - Free online audio “magazine”. Text articles from intermediate – advanced with audio in Latin American or Spain dialects.
  • ITunes Spanish I by Arkansas – This self-paced course is a good introduction for those who have never studied it before, or a good supplemental program for students who may be struggling in their school class, or a good refresher course for people who would like to brush up on Spanish after years of not having studied it, 28 lessons.
  • ITunes Spanish II by Arkansas – In this course, students will learn to talk about the past and will learn several other fundamental grammatical principles to further their ability to communicate in Spanish, 4 lessons
  • ITunes Spanish III by Arkansas –  4 lessons
  • - Podcasts for learners of all levels
  • 5 Minute Spanish – These concise videos cut straight to the point in explaining introductory Spanish grammar concepts
  • - Audio lessons that cover several subject areas
  • Forvo - About 70000 words pronounced by native speakers


  • BBC - Immersive video series to help you learn simple Spanish
  • YouTube - Hundreds of Spanish TV shows
  • - Travel the world with lawyer Raquel Rodríguez as she solves a mystery for a dying man. Watch the complete Destinos series, practice your Spanish, and find new resources for learning and teaching.
  • YouTube LightSpeed Spanish – Huge number of videos – from basic lessons, vocabulary to grammar lessons and interviews with native speakers
  • YouTube Butterfly Spanish – Learn and improve your vocabulary, phrases, grammar, pronunciation and tips with these useful lessons. Mostly for beginners.
  • YouTube Professor Jason Spanish – videos for learners of all levels which are presented in a slightly more formal way
  • YouTube - A list of YT video lessons
  • - A list of about 40 TV stations from Spain (with description)
  • - A list of about 16 TV stations from Mexico (with description)
  • - A list of 9 TV stations from Colombia (with description)
  • - A list of 9 TV stations from Chile (with description)
  • - A list of 9 TV stations from Venezuela (with description)
  • Reddit - Over 130 movies (with links and subtitles)
  • - Huge list of Spanish movies with descriptions (but without links)


  • - Over 1000 stations from Spanish speaking countries


If you want to help with expanding this list of resources, please send me your suggestions here.